About Dancing Joker

Dancing Joker puts a joker character front and center on a standard 5-reel layout. The joker acts as a wild symbol, stepping in for other symbols to complete winning lines. You choose your bet amount, spin the reels, and the game evaluates your results against its paytable. Jokers appear with their own frequency, so you won't see them on every spin, but when they do land, they can complete combos that wouldn't work otherwise. The slot plays like most others, with the joker mechanic handling a bigger role in how wins form.
